1.1 root 1: /* dgram.h */
2:
3: /* Datagram pseudo-device control block */
4:
5: struct dgblk { /* Datagram device control block*/
6: int dg_dnum; /* device number of this device */
7: int dg_state; /* whether this device allocated*/
8: int dg_lport; /* local datagram port number */
9: int dg_fport; /* foreign datagram port number */
10: IPaddr dg_faddr; /* foreign machine IP address */
11: int dg_xport; /* incoming packet queue */
12: int dg_netq; /* index of our netq entry */
13: int dg_mode; /* mode of this interface */
14: };
15:
16: /* Datagram psuedo-device state constants */
17:
18: #define DG_FREE 0 /* this device is available */
19: #define DG_USED 1 /* this device is in use */
20:
21: #define DG_TIME 30 /* read timeout (tenths of sec) */
22:
23: /* Constants for dgm pseudo-device control functions */
24:
25: #define DGM_GATE 11 /* Set the default gateway */
26:
27: /* Constants for dg pseudo-device control functions */
28:
29: #define DG_SETMODE 1 /* Set mode of device */
30: #define DG_CLEAR 2 /* clear all waiting datagrams */
31:
32: /* Constants for dg pseudo-device mode bits */
33:
34: #define DG_NMODE 001 /* normal (datagram) mode */
35: #define DG_DMODE 002 /* data-only mode */
36: #define DG_TMODE 040 /* timeout all reads */
37:
38: /* Structure of xinugram as dg interface delivers it to user */
39:
40: struct xgram { /* Xinu datagram (not UDP) */
41: IPaddr xg_faddr; /* foreign host IP address */
42: short xg_fport; /* foreign UDP port number */
43: short xg_lport; /* local UDP port number */
44: char xg_data[UMAXLEN]; /* maximum data to/from UDP */
45: };
46:
47: #define XGHLEN 8 /* error in ( (sizeof(struct xgram)) - UMAXLEN) */
48:
49: /* Constants for port specifications on INTERNET open call */
50:
51: #define ANYFPORT (char *)0 /* Accept any foreign UDP port */
52: #define ANYLPORT 0 /* Assign a fresh local port num*/
53:
54: extern struct dgblk dgtab[];
